Is Fontainebleau free?

Admission to the château de Fontainebleau is free: on the first Sunday of each month, except July and August; during certain national events: European Museum Night, Art History Festival, European Heritage Days. Non-exhaustive list, depending on government policy. What is Fontainebleau famous for?

The Palace of Fontainebleau, a royal residence of the French sovereigns until the 19th century, was constantly maintained and enriched with artistic additions and is also associated with important historical events that occurred there, such as the repeal of the Edict of Nantes, in 1685, and the abdication of Napoleon I . History took place within the walls of this Chateau, becoming the “True home of kings, house of centuries“, as Napoleon I liked to call it. Inhabited by great historical figures, like Catherine de Medici, Louis XIV or Marie Antoinette, the Chateau de Fontainebleau is an outstanding testimony of History.
